Conservatives snub residents on Keys Hall petition - UPDATE

Members of the Liberal Democrat group on Brentwood Borough Council have slammed the Conservative administration for snubbing the residents who signed the save Keys Hall petition. The 620 strong petition collected by the Lib Dems was on the agenda at June's Policy Committee but when it came to discussing the item the Conservatives said they simply "noted" it.

Olympic Legacy: Sculpture or Athletics Track?

Cllr David Kendall, leader of the Lib Dem Group on Brentwood Borough Council, has called for Brentwood's 2012 Olympic legacy to be the building of an athletics track and possible stadium at the Brentwood Centre.

Conservatives vote in 147 more flats in Wharf Road

At the Planning meeting on Wednesday 23rd May 2007, the Conservatives voted through the final phase of the 350 flats on the old gas works site in Wharf Road, now known as "The Base", despite strong protests from the Liberal Democrat group.

Straw calls for 20mph zone

In May 2007, at the Annual Council meeting, Cllr Reg Straw presented a petition that called for the provision of a 20mph zone in the Brentwood North Community Zone.

Fight to save Keys Hall goes on

At the Annual Council meeting on 16th May, newly elected Liberal Democrat Councillor Karen Chilvers presented the petition to save Keys Hall, the community facility that was voted "surplus to leisure and recreational requirements" recently.
